Geothermal to Heat More Boise State Buildings
A project that will link Boise State University to the city of Boise’s geothermal system is moving full steam ahead, with university officials expecting nearly 1 million square feet of campus space to be heated with the naturally heated underground water over the next few years.

Grants Bring More Geothermal Research, Projects to Idaho
The U.S. Department of Energy will send more than $10 million in grants to Idaho for geothermal research and projects, the agency announced. An additional $3.8 million will go to Boise firm US Geothermal for a project the company has underway in Nevada.

BSU Works with Government, Industry to Improve Wind Power Efficiency
Predicting when and how forcefully wind will drive power generation down to the blades of a turbine would help solve several fundamental problems faced by wind power – from the lack of storage on transmission grids, to the variability of wind currents. By using a combination of meteorology, mechanical engineering and computer science, researchers at the Boise State University College of Engineering are developing a system that may provide a solution.
